I just got an Apple Watch a couple months ago. I plan on using it on my upcoming cruise. I do not plan on purchasing an internet package. That being said, what features will/won’t work? I know the HUB app isn’t Apple Watch compatible, so I won’t get those notifications, what else?

I've gone on two cruises with my Apple Watch, the first I did not have an internet plan at all and the second I had the social plan.

 

Activity tracking will still work, as will basic watch functionality (including alarms, stopwatches, etc). GPS-based workouts will obviously be wonky if the ship is moving, but step tracking still seemed to work fine.

 

Hub app notifications actually do show up on your watch. You just have to go to your iPhone to see more than just the notification.

 

As a side note, the funny thing about having the social plan was that all push notifications actually came through (including news alerts, etc) even though I couldn't use that app...

GPS was hilarious as when I was walking around the track it seemed to be tracking up really fast. I did a mile I think in 3 min lol. But step tracking is fine and any apps that it syncs with will generally sync up once you get back on line as everything is stored in the Health app anyways.

I walked ~four miles while on a sea day on the Dream Promenade Deck. My GPS on the Apple Watch picked up the forward movement of the ship and recorded >20 miles. The rest of the trip I used it as an “indoor walk” and it got closer to the real walking distance. [emoji41]

Last week on the Magic, several people were talking about their smart watches and they forgot at first that the watch would self adjust to whatever time zone they were in. Remember to always stay on ship time in port.

 

Neither my watch nor my phone ever changed time zone. It is set by the cell network and it never touched the cell network, just the internet via wifi. ATT was the provider.
